WebAn NCAA basketball court will be 94 feet in length by 50 wide, with the half court line at 47 feet, directly in the center of the court. The free throw line is 19 feet from the edge of the court and 15 feet from the front of the … Web14 sep. 2024 · The basketball key lines for the NBA are wider. The official dimensions are as follow. NBA key is 16’ wide by 19’ from baseline to free throw line. The 19’ include the 4’ backboard overhang. College and High …

NBA basketball courts have a 16-foot (4.9 m) rectangular key. Hash marks in an arc mark the portion of the circle for jump balls at the free throw line. Keys may have both NBA and NCAA or NAIA marking to allow use of the same floor by both organizations.
